Alex Cora sent the classiest email to the Red Sox organization after his firing
Cora had a nice message for all his former colleagues.
Despite leading the Red Sox to a World Series title in 2018 and the ALCS last season, Alex Cora evidently entered the season on the hot seat as he was fired after a 10-17 start . Cora would've had every reason to feel betrayed after such a shocking decision. But that wasn't what happened at all with the former manager and player.
He went out of his way to pen a nice email to the entire Red Sox organization. And honestly, it's tough to imagine a manager handling a firing any better than Cora did here. MassLive obtained the email on Wednesday, and it was worth a read.
Cora wrote: โGood morning. I wanted to take a moment before heading home to thank you. Being part of this organization has meant a great deal to me.
As a player and as a manager. Like I always tell free agents, Iโm glad my kids grew up here. Itโs unique, special and magical.
